
The Consorzio del vino Brunello di Montalcino is starting again from the United States, flying to New York on February 4th for the stars and stripes edition of Benvenuto Brunello. The appointment with the new 2020 vintage and the 2019 Riserva of the prince of Tuscan reds is on Fortieth Street, where at the GH on the Park in Manhattan 34 producers will meet over 450 operators and US press.
“In a general context of great uncertainty for the wine market, it is essential for us to continue to monitor our main outlet, where we allocate over 30% of our exports – comments the president of the Brunello di Montalcino Wine Consortium Fabrizio Bindocci.
